“Traditional” producer tries Suno: here are my honest thoughts. by FunPaleontologist29 in SunoAI

[–]SecurePhone2301 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I’m new to Suno, but what seems to work best for me is singing a snippet and providing a prompt, seeing what it renders and then finalizing the lyrics through the cover feature and continuing to do that until it sounds like I’d like. When you add a reference track it tries to be similar.

I’ve listened to some songs others have made and you can absolutely tell who is writing their own lyrics and who’s just using ai to create a song. I’m not a professional by any means but I really like what I’m able to create

Vercel and Bluehost HELP PLEASE by SecurePhone2301 in vercel

[–]SecurePhone2301[S] 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I just so happened to be online when you responded. Thank you for this. I figured it out and it was a total newb mistake. Bluehost was definitely auto repopulating the domain after 24-48 hours with the name servers pointed to bluehost. I ultimately did change the name servers to Vercel, but did not add the bluehost records to vercel (originally it was the other way around) . I honestly couldn’t believe the oversight. This isn’t something I do every day and it had me panicking but crisis averted!
